Asia Employment Update: TikTok Shop to Implement Major Layoffs in Indonesia

In a notable development within the challenging economic environment, TikTok Shop has revealed plans for considerable layoffs in Indonesia, signaling a strategic realignment for the platform in one of its crucial markets.This decision mirrors broader trends across the technology sector, where businesses are grappling with escalating operational expenses and evolving consumer behaviors following the pandemic. This article is part of our ongoing Asia Employment Update series and will delve into the ramifications of TikTok Shop’s upcoming workforce reductions, explore contributing factors to this shift, and examine how it fits into the larger narrative of job cuts throughout Southeast Asia’s thriving tech industry. Given that Indonesia serves as a vital center for digital commerce in Southeast Asia, these layoffs prompt critical questions regarding the future landscape of online retail and employment within this sector.

The declaration from TikTok Shop regarding notable staff reductions in Indonesia highlights a strategic shift that emphasizes both operational hurdles and changing priorities within e-commerce. As the company retracts its workforce, it raises crucial considerations about competitive dynamics within an increasingly fragmented market. Recently, firms like TikTok Shop have encountered mounting pressures such as regulatory challenges, evolving consumer preferences, and heightened competition—all prompting them to clarify their strategic focus areas. Considering these obstacles, TikTok’s approach indicates a broader trend among digital-first companies recalibrating their strategies towards sustainability rather than mere expansion.

Experts identify several pivotal factors driving this trend across the region:

  • Heightened Competition: With numerous local and international entities competing for market share, establishing differentiation is becoming essential.
  • Evolving Consumer Preferences: A growing demand for personalized and sustainable shopping experiences is reshaping how businesses connect with customers.
  • Regulatory Challenges: Increased government scrutiny on data privacy practices is compelling e-commerce platforms to reassess their operational frameworks.
  • Pursuit of Profitability: The transition from prioritizing growth at any cost to focusing on profit margins has become an essential discussion point among tech firms.

Effects of Layoffs on Indonesia’s Digital Economy and Workforce Stability

TikTok Shop’s recent decision to implement significant layoffs raises urgent concerns about potential repercussions for both Indonesia’s digital economy and overall workforce stability. As one of Southeast Asia’s fastest-growing online markets, Indonesia had experienced an influx of digital startups creating thousands of job opportunities; though,the anticipated cuts pose risks to this ecosystem reliant on talent innovation.The immediate loss of jobs may not only impact individuals but also lead to reduced consumer spending—further straining local businesses still recovering from pandemic-related setbacks.

Additonally,the layoffs could intensify existing issues within Indonesia’s labor market where skilled professionals might find themselves seeking new roles amidst increasing competition. As organizations like TikTok reduce their workforces,the potential wider impacts may include:

  • A talent exodus as skilled workers pursue opportunities abroad or transition into more stable sectors.
  • A deceleration in technological progress due to diminished human capital resources.
  • An increased burden on governmental bodies alongside educational institutions tasked with implementing retraining programs aimed at transitioning displaced workers into new positions.
